当前位置: 首页 > news >正文

你还不会选ProfiNET和EtherCAT网线?

在现代工业自动化领域,ProfiNET和EtherCAT是两种非常流行的通信协议。选择合适的网线对于确保通信的稳定性和效率至关重要。

ProfiNET是什么?

ProfiNET是一种基于以太网的通信协议,由德国西门子公司开发。它支持实时通信,广泛应用于自动化控制系统中,如工业机器人、输送带和加工设备。ProfiNET协议能够确保数据传输的实时性和可靠性,非常适合需要高速数据交换和控制的应用场景。

EtherCAT是什么?

EtherCAT(Ethernet for Control Automation Technology)也是一种基于以太网的通信协议,由德国倍福自动化公司开发。它以极低的延迟和高效率著称,特别适合于要求严格同步和高实时性的应用,如运动控制和精密机械。

ProfiNET和EtherCAT使用场景

ProfiNET使用场景:

  • 大规模自动化生产线:由于其稳定的通信特性,ProfiNET适合用于大规模的生产线,确保各个环节的数据同步和控制。
  • 分布式控制系统:在需要多个控制单元协同工作的场合,ProfiNET能够提供可靠的数据交换。

EtherCAT使用场景:

  • 高精度机械加工:EtherCAT的低延迟特性使其成为高精度机械加工和机器人控制的理想选择。
  • 同步运动控制:在需要多个设备严格同步运动的场合,EtherCAT能够提供精确的控制。
不同场景应该选怎么样的网线?

对于ProfiNET:

  • 工业级以太网线:由于ProfiNET协议对稳定性有较高要求,推荐使用工业级以太网线,这类网线具有更强的抗干扰能力和耐用性。
  • 屏蔽网线:在电磁干扰较大的环境下,使用屏蔽网线可以减少信号衰减和干扰,保证通信质量。

对于EtherCAT:

  • 高性能以太网线:由于EtherCAT对传输速率和延迟有严格要求,应选择高性能的以太网线,以确保数据传输的高速和低延迟。
  • 光纤以太网线:在长距离传输或需要极高数据传输速率的场合,光纤以太网线是更好的选择,它可以提供更远的传输距离和更高的带宽。

总之,选择ProfiNET和EtherCAT网线时,需要考虑通信协议的特性、应用场景的需求以及环境因素。正确的网线选择将直接影响到系统的稳定性和效率。

作者介绍:

90后资深架构师,深耕工业可视化,数字化转型,深度学习技术在工业中的应用。深入研究Web3D,SCADA ,深度学习开发应用。开发语言技能JAVA/C#/Python/Golang/Vue3/TypeScript, 关注【工业可视化】带你一起学~

相关文章:

  • JavaWeb测试卷
  • 多元多项式的特征列与零点的关系定理
  • 代码解读 | Hybrid Transformers for Music Source Separation[07]
  • 从中概回购潮,看互联网的未来
  • 一文彻底理解机器学习 ROC-AUC 指标
  • QT向已有ZIP中追加文件
  • (55)MOS管专题--->(10)MOS管的封装
  • WBTC与BTC的主要区别
  • 内网安全【2】-域防火墙
  • C++链表相关内容温习回顾——移除链表元素
  • 线程池吞掉异常的case:源码阅读与解决方法
  • 【Python支持多种数据类型及案列】
  • ROS系统中解析通过CAN协议传输的超声波传感器数据
  • nginx安装环境部署(完整步骤)
  • java如何截取字符串
  • [数据结构]链表的实现在PHP中
  • 「前端早读君006」移动开发必备:那些玩转H5的小技巧
  • 【腾讯Bugly干货分享】从0到1打造直播 App
  • iOS 颜色设置看我就够了
  • jdbc就是这么简单
  • node学习系列之简单文件上传
  • scala基础语法(二)
  • spring security oauth2 password授权模式
  • vue 个人积累(使用工具,组件)
  • Webpack入门之遇到的那些坑,系列示例Demo
  • zookeeper系列(七)实战分布式命名服务
  • 规范化安全开发 KOA 手脚架
  • 基于webpack 的 vue 多页架构
  • 简单基于spring的redis配置(单机和集群模式)
  • 区块链分支循环
  • 入门到放弃node系列之Hello Word篇
  • 使用docker-compose进行多节点部署
  • 温故知新之javascript面向对象
  • 我是如何设计 Upload 上传组件的
  • 一个6年java程序员的工作感悟,写给还在迷茫的你
  • 智能网联汽车信息安全
  • 你学不懂C语言,是因为不懂编写C程序的7个步骤 ...
  • # C++之functional库用法整理
  • #我与Java虚拟机的故事#连载18:JAVA成长之路
  • (a /b)*c的值
  • (八)光盘的挂载与解挂、挂载CentOS镜像、rpm安装软件详细学习笔记
  • (动态规划)5. 最长回文子串 java解决
  • (附源码)springboot高校宿舍交电费系统 毕业设计031552
  • (附源码)springboot助农电商系统 毕业设计 081919
  • (六)激光线扫描-三维重建
  • (十三)Java springcloud B2B2C o2o多用户商城 springcloud架构 - SSO单点登录之OAuth2.0 根据token获取用户信息(4)...
  • (使用vite搭建vue3项目(vite + vue3 + vue router + pinia + element plus))
  • (详细版)Vary: Scaling up the Vision Vocabulary for Large Vision-Language Models
  • (一)u-boot-nand.bin的下载
  • (转)fock函数详解
  • (转)ORM
  • (轉貼) UML中文FAQ (OO) (UML)
  • ***利用Ms05002溢出找“肉鸡
  • .FileZilla的使用和主动模式被动模式介绍
  • .NET 8 中引入新的 IHostedLifecycleService 接口 实现定时任务